radioButtons
radioButtons(inputId, label, choices, selected = NULL, inline = FALSE)
Arguments
inputId | Input variable to assign the control's value to |
---|---|
label | Display label for the control, or NULL |
choices | List of values to select from (if elements of the list are named then that name rather than the value is displayed to the user) |
selected | The initially selected value (if not specified then defaults to the first value) |
inline | If TRUE , render the choices inline (i.e. horizontally) |
Create radio buttons
Value
A set of radio buttons that can be added to a UI definition.
Description
Create a set of radio buttons used to select an item from a list.
Examples
radioButtons("dist", "Distribution type:", c("Normal" = "norm", "Uniform" = "unif", "Log-normal" = "lnorm", "Exponential" = "exp"))<div id="dist" class="control-group shiny-input-radiogroup"> <label class="control-label" for="dist">Distribution type:</label> <label class="radio"> <input type="radio" name="dist" id="dist1" value="norm" checked="checked"/> <span>Normal</span> </label> <label class="radio"> <input type="radio" name="dist" id="dist2" value="unif"/> <span>Uniform</span> </label> <label class="radio"> <input type="radio" name="dist" id="dist3" value="lnorm"/> <span>Log-normal</span> </label> <label class="radio"> <input type="radio" name="dist" id="dist4" value="exp"/> <span>Exponential</span> </label> </div>
See also
updateRadioButtons
Other input.elements: actionButton
,
actionLink
; animationOptions
,
sliderInput
;
checkboxGroupInput
;
checkboxInput
; dateInput
;
dateRangeInput
; fileInput
;
numericInput
; selectInput
,
selectizeInput
; submitButton
;
textInput